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14984599 9822 222190616 22 90
455094 314 2937017866
455094 314 2937017866
689 695707 84024
All about undefined
Interested in learning more?
455094 314 2937017866
689 695707 84024
See more
110 53643080
71 649855985 79141 41632
See more
3357881 4801
9893717 0143 79041838 177106 2137016554
See more